Maybe some parts were wrong in the analysis:
- "They had better weapons than PLA (Chinese+Soviet+US made)" - Yes, for the major force of VPA. But that force was busy dealing with the Khmer Rouge in Feb 1979. Although Phnompen was taken on Jan 7th (after 1-2 weeks of blitzkrieg (or so-spelled :-), VPA was having to chase the Khmer Rouge to Thai border. Fighting against PLA were mostly border patrol units (many of those were ethnic). (BTW, VN saved Cambodian from extinction but I dont know why they dont like VNmese.)
All captured American were quite high tech at that time (F-5, M-48, etc) but totally useless because VPA have no compatible parts, ammunition, no one who understand English in 1975.

- "(China established) better relations with other countries - Cambordia, Laos, Thailand...": Not with Laos and Cambodia until recently. After 79, VN has secured his eastern flank by having Laos and Cambodia became VN's close allies.

- "At the end, it also mentioned that India is on the same road as what the Viet Nam was in 1979 by claiming China is their number one enemy and will get their due": Actually, China has always been VN's number one threat in his history - except for some short periods.

- "Weaken a potential enemy": this point is right. VN had always been weakened after fighting against his giant neighbor - even with a victory. In history, there were many times that VNmese kings sent ambassadors with gold (and nice girls) to Chinese emperor after winning a war against it, in order to make a little peace.
